SWIFT and Ripple’s Role in Payments
SWIFT, the Society for Worldwide Interbank Financial Telecommunication, is the leading messaging system for financial transactions, covering payments, foreign exchange, and securities. JackTheRippler shared a video featuring its systems and a potential role Ripple and XRP could play.
Traditionally, SWIFT operates on a “store and forward” system that relies on service-level agreements, meaning transactions are processed within predefined timeframes rather than instantly. However, cryptocurrencies like XRP could enhance payment systems by enabling real-time fund movement and visibility.
The speaker in the video noted that with traditional SWIFT transactions, banks often need to follow up on payments days later, whereas digital asset solutions eliminate such delays.
He stated that he doesn’t believe Ripple will replace SWIFT, but believes the company can offer a complementary system by providing real-time payment processing to anyone who needs it through XRP.

XRP’s Possible Integration with SWIFT
While SWIFT has been adapting to modern financial demands, including real-time transaction capabilities, there is growing speculation about XRP’s role in these developments.
The speaker acknowledged the possibility of the use of XRP on the SWIFT network in foreign exchange (FX) transactions, which could provide liquidity benefits and faster settlements.
Ripple’s technology, specifically its On-Demand Liquidity (ODL) service, facilitates cross-border payments without the need for pre-funded accounts. If integrated with SWIFT’s infrastructure, XRP could serve as a bridge asset for faster and more cost-effective transfers.
